How to Send Recive Free Text Messages


1. Log in to your email account. In the 'To' field enter the 10-digit phone number you wish to text followed by the carrier email address code. For example, if you wish to text an email to the phone number 555-123-4567 on the T-Mobile network, you would enter 5551234567@tomomail.net into your email address field. Some of the more common wireless network carrier codes are: AT&T---XXX@txt.att.net, Verizon---XXX@vtext.com, Alltel---XXX@message.alltel.com, Nextel---XXX@messaging.nextel.com, Boost---XXX@myboostmobile.com, US Cellular---XXX@email.uscc.net, Sprint PCS---XXX@messaging.sprintpcs.com, Virgin Mobile---XXX@email.vmobi.com (for complete list, see Resources). Simply replace the XXX with the 10-digit phone number you wish to email a text to.
2. Compose your text email. Text messages are usually only sent in 160 characters or less, so keep this in mind before sending your email text. A message longer than 160 characters can get cut short and not fully delivered to the cell phone you are texting.
3. Send your email. The text you included in your email will now be sent to the cell phone number you listed in the 'To' address field. When the person you text messaged replies, you will receive an email in your in-box with their response. To continue texting back and forth, simply reply to the received email in your in-box.
